Draught @ Brauerei Göller Drosendorf, Drosendorf, Germany. Clear medium yellow color with a average, frothy, good lacing, mostly lasting, white head. Aroma is moderate malty, grain, hay, straw, toasted, moderate hoppy, grass. Flavor is moderate to light heavy sweet and bitter with a average duration. Body is medium, texture is oily, carbonation is soft. (230308)

Mug at the brewery in Drosendorf. Yellow and unfiltered with a white head. Nose of fruity lemon and sweet cracker-pils malt and some sweet dough. Flavor is wet and oily, medium to full bodies, with a light hoppy bite and light crispness in the finish, but generally it stays oily, wet, and semi-tart throughout the drink.

Tap, at the brewpub. Jan 2005. Hazy Gold, Good white head and moderate condition. Pleasantly hoppy aroma with a background of sulphur, but less obvious than the in the Dunkle. Solid and well balanced malt and hops in the mouth and a long lingering pilsner hoppy finish. By far the best of their beers that I tried.

Bottle, bought at the brewery. Label says brewed by Göller in Zeil am Main. Is this tiny brewery with the big beer garden still brewing? Does it only brew a bit of tap beer for its own premises (see rating Ohmper)? Malty aroma, with peach and a hint of boiled milk. Malty flavor: clearly hopbitter with hay and vanilla. Rather thin, especially for a Franconian pilsener. Hopbitter and hay aftertaste.
